Prerequisites
Before diving into these practice exams, let’s be realistic about prerequisites. This is a CCNP-level exam, so a solid understanding of fundamental networking (CCNA-level and beyond) is your baseline. You’ll definitely need prior experience with scripting, particularly Python for network automation. This isn’t a Python tutorial; it assumes you can read/write basic scripts, understand data structures, and interact with APIs. Familiarity with Linux CLIs and Git version control is also non-negotiable. While the questions cover REST APIs, NETCONF/RESTCONF, and YANG, a conceptual understanding before starting will greatly improve efficiency. This product validates advanced knowledge, so come prepared with a decent foundation in networking and programming.
